Samsung Q8FN QLED Series Smart TV Review

 

Samsung Q8FN QLED Series Smart TV Review

 

Samsung Q8FN QLED series is good for semi-professional, professional works. We tested the 55″ sibling. It does come in more sizes including 75″. Good packaging, but not closest that of Apple’s quality of packaging. Unboxing over 43″ sets demands two persons and a carpet (or table) two screw the stands.

The build quality of the set is great, good quality plastic used and some real metal parts used. The frame is thin, around half inch wide at front, there is a gap between the frame and pixels of the display. Rear panel has four HDMI ports (one supports ARC), one coaxial connector, two USB ports, one ethernet port, one optical audio output, 3.5mm ports for A/V input from various old devices.

Does metal stand, metal bezel border cost how much extra? Questionable but none to answer. Samsung NU7100 series has 1 multi-functional button under the center of the TV, which better needs a mirror or glass surface to guess the location. Samsung Q8FN QLED series has 5 button at the same place practically pointing to use the remote control unit. That is usual design of these days. Back panel of Samsung Q8FN QLED is similar to Samsung 7100 series.

Samsung Q8FN series delivers excellent image quality, great HDR, great local dimming performance, almost perfect to handle motion blur and most importantly supports refresh rate up to 120Hz. Quantum-dot technology definitely delivers vibrant and accurate color. The difference of price between 55″ TV from NU7100 series and 55″ Q8FN QLED series is too obvious while watching own recorded movies and photos. Q8FN has full array direct backlighting.
Over and above the 2018 NU7100 series, there is Bixby, premium quality remote with voice control, beautiful stand and bezel, slightly improved version of Tizen OS and of course better image processing. There is a kind of moiré which Sony is infamous to create and image slightly loss sharpness.

Samsung’s ambient mode is a trick – using their app to take a picture of the TV’s surroundings can create an on-display wallpaper making as if the TV background is visible through & through. Is this feature made by engineers to fool the kids?
